> The Thunderbolt framework relies on the USB core to create device links
> for tunneled ports, so that the USB3 controller is only kept
> runtime-resumed for the duration of the tunneling.
>
> Currently, retrieving that information is only possibe on Intel XHCI
> hosts, through a vendor-specific capability. Extend xhci-plat to allow
> plumbing a custom one.

> @@ -22,6 +22,7 @@ struct xhci_plat_priv {
> int (*suspend_quirk)(struct usb_hcd *);
> int (*resume_quirk)(struct usb_hcd *);
> int (*post_resume_quirk)(struct usb_hcd *);
> + enum usb_link_tunnel_mode (*tunnel_mode)(struct usb_hcd *hcd, int portnum);
We should add a boolean tunnel_mode_override. When set, ->tunnel_mode()
is called before the standard xhci v1.2 ext_cap check. If the
->tunnel_mode() returns USB_LINK_UNKNOWN, go to the standard path. This
allows the quirk to selectively bypass or override it.
